  • Title

    Equivalent circuit of the leaky coaxial cable with rectangular slots

  • Abstract
    This paper presents an equivalent circuit model for leaky coaxial cable with rectangular slots, the circuit model is analyzed with the help of commercial software-HFSS. The results show that the mutual coupling between slots is tiny, and can be neglected, even for the two close adjoining slots. The effect of rectangular slot parameters, such as flare angle, inclined angle, on the impedance of the circuit model is analyzed, and the corresponding radiation characteristic of the slots is then evaluated through the real part of impedance of the slot. The method of using coupling loss to compensate the transmission loss is discussed. Finally, an efficient method for calculating S-parameter of the whole LCX is given.
